I am looking to make a high pressure air/CO2 stream. I have a mixing system which generates a 120 psi stream, which I then want to compress to 1500 psi. We do this with CO2/N2 now without issue, I was concerned that the O2 at this pressure would require special equipment. Does any one know any relevant safety material?

Dave
 
Are you addressing the level of oxygen in air (implied by the thread title); or an oxygen application?

If oxygen, we can list several standards available on the web for free that you should review.
 
Oxygen in the air being compressed, about 15% v/v.
